Transaction 67ab990fa1fd50db62f32b3bccfea9b04c0188286c670e377aeb299953948078
1 Input
1 Output
-
67ab990fa1fd50db62f32b3bccfea9b04c0188286c670e377aeb299953948078:0
- value
- 59714
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17462632ab4333cadbbf795f1f4a240487ddf986 OP_EQUAL
- address
- 33p5W1ShkBWV6QC1nzZGfpdwWDLS9mVgEK